Finance Review Summary — Customer Concentration Risk

Quick one for branch managers: this quarter's review flagged that Drossmere Holdings now accounts for nearly 38% of our Calderstone division revenue — higher than we'd like, honestly. If they sneeze, we all catch a cold. We're not panicking, but branches should start nudging mid-size prospects up the pipeline and avoid leaning on Drossmere volume in your forecasts. Ines has asked for diversification targets by branch before month-end. The plan for how we rebalance is laid out just below.

management briefing: Jorixax Holdings is in early talks to buy Casixax Holdings for about $420.3 million. The Fenmir launch date is October 27, and nothing goes to the press before then. Legal wants the Keloxek Foods term sheet redrafted before April 16.

// Sandbox limits for user-supplied formulas in the Quillbarrow
// sheet engine. This constant caps evaluation depth before the
// interpreter bails; raising it widens the blast radius of
// malicious recursion and must be signed off by the release
// manager. Formulas exceeding the cap return a soft error, not
// a crash — keep it that way. Loops, I/O, and reflection stay
// blocked regardless of this value. The cap was last validated
// under the build noted below.

pipeline stamp: htk9_ce63042d9

Ticket: Metrics sidecar vault locked after failed unseal

Welcome aboard — since you're new to the Pellwick platform, here's context. The Gravlet metrics-aggregation sidecar stores its scrape credentials in a small vault that sealed itself after three failed unseal attempts during last night's node reboot. Until it's unsealed, dashboards for the Harlowe cluster show gaps. Follow the unseal steps in the sidecar runbook, section 4, and verify scrape resumption afterward. The recovery passphrase you'll need is appended directly below this line.

vault phrase of tawef-baduf = julox-eliir-ulaix-rusok-novael-sorael-tammir-ulaok-casvan-rusius-olimir-kasath-kelius